What skills, knowledge and experience will you need?

  • Strong experience using Google Analytics to understand how users interact with digital services and identify where journeys work well or break down.
  • Confidence writing and using SQL to explore data, join multiple datasets, perform calculations, and answer real questions about service performance.
  • Experience working with Google BigQuery to analyse large datasets and support performance reporting.
  • Ability to define success measures and KPIs, starting from user needs and business goals rather than pre-defined metrics.
  • Experience working with people, not in isolation - collaborating with product teams to agree what should be measured and why.
  • Confidence turning data into clear insight and recommendations, not just dashboards or numbers.
  • Ability to see the bigger picture, understanding how individual measures fit together to tell a meaningful story about service performance and impact.

You and your role

Performance Analysts in DWP shape how digital services are designed, measured and improved. You’ll work closely with multidisciplinary teams to ensure measurement is built into services from the start, helping teams understand whether what they’re delivering is actually making things better for users. You’ll design and maintain performance measurement frameworks, including KPIs that reflect both user needs and organisational priorities. You’ll also be responsible for implementing and optimising tagging strategies to enhance the visibility of service interactions and user journeys. You’ll help us understand how data is being captured and used across service lines to measure performance and identify areas for improvement.

You will move our teams beyond surface-level metrics by exploring how users move through services, where friction exists and what the data is really telling us about outcomes. You will be working with Google Analytics data and writing SQL in Google BigQuery to bring together different data sources, create meaningful analysis, and support clear and reliable dashboards using tools like Looker Studio and Power BI. Just as importantly, you’ll spend time explaining what the data means. This could be tailoring insight for different audiences or helping teams use it to inform future decisions. Your work will help colleagues change what they do in the future, using evidence to improve services and better meet user needs.
